第一单元《第5课 色辨成音-“如果”结构和“广播”命令》教学设计-2023-2024学年清华版(2012)信息技术五年级下册_第1页
第一单元《第5课 色辨成音-“如果”结构和“广播”命令》教学设计-2023-2024学年清华版(2012)信息技术五年级下册_第2页
第一单元《第5课 色辨成音-“如果”结构和“广播”命令》教学设计-2023-2024学年清华版(2012)信息技术五年级下册_第3页
第一单元《第5课 色辨成音-“如果”结构和“广播”命令》教学设计-2023-2024学年清华版(2012)信息技术五年级下册_第4页
第一单元《第5课 色辨成音-“如果”结构和“广播”命令》教学设计-2023-2024学年清华版(2012)信息技术五年级下册_第5页
已阅读5页,还剩2页未读 继续免费阅读

付费下载

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

第一单元《第5课色辨成音——“如果”结构和“广播”命令》教学设计-2023-2024学年清华版(2012)信息技术五年级下册授课内容授课时数授课班级授课人数授课地点授课时间教材分析本章节内容选自《第5课色辨成音——“如果”结构和“广播”命令》,2023-2024学年清华版信息技术五年级下册教材。本课旨在帮助学生掌握“如果”条件和“广播”命令在程序设计中的应用,通过具体案例教学,让学生在掌握基础概念的同时,能够运用所学知识进行简单的程序编写,提升信息技术素养。核心素养目标培养学生信息意识,通过“如果”结构和“广播”命令的学习,提升逻辑思维和问题解决能力。增强数字化学习与创新素养,使学生能够运用编程思维设计简单程序,培养计算思维和算法意识。同时,强化信息社会责任感,引导学生正确使用信息技术,培养合作学习与交流能力。教学难点与重点1.教学重点,

①理解“如果”条件和“广播”命令在程序中的作用和逻辑关系;

②能够根据具体问题设计程序,运用“如果”条件和“广播”命令实现程序的功能;

③掌握编写简单程序的基本步骤,包括分析问题、设计算法、编写代码和调试程序。

2.教学难点,

①理解“如果”条件中的逻辑判断和条件分支的概念,并能正确应用;

②在程序设计中合理运用“广播”命令,实现信息的有效传递和共享;

③在编写程序时,能够处理简单的错误和异常情况,进行调试和优化;

④将实际问题转化为程序设计问题,并设计出符合逻辑和功能需求的程序。教学资源准备1.教材:确保每位学生都拥有《信息技术五年级下册》教材,并准备相应的教学讲义。

2.辅助材料:准备与“如果”结构和“广播”命令相关的图片、流程图和实例视频,以辅助学生理解。

3.实验器材:准备编程软件和必要的硬件设备,如电脑,确保学生能够进行编程实践。

4.教室布置:设置分组讨论区,为学生提供足够的桌面空间,并准备实验操作台,以便学生分组操作。教学过程1.导入(约5分钟)

-激发兴趣:以“同学们,你们知道什么是编程吗?今天我们就来探索一下编程中的一个小奥秘——条件语句。”这样的问题引入课程。

-回顾旧知:引导学生回顾之前学过的编程基础,如变量、循环等概念。

2.新课呈现(约30分钟)

-讲解新知:

-详细讲解“如果”结构和“广播”命令的基本概念、语法规则和执行流程。

-通过幻灯片或投影展示“如果”结构和“广播”命令的示例代码。

-举例说明:

-以现实生活中的情境为例,如温度控制程序,说明“如果”条件在程序中的应用。

-展示“广播”命令在多人互动游戏中的应用,如角色之间的信息传递。

-互动探究:

-引导学生分组讨论,根据所学知识设计一个简单的程序,并讨论如何使用“如果”条件和“广播”命令实现功能。

-安排学生进行小组实验,利用编程软件尝试编写程序,并演示给全班同学。

3.巩固练习(约20分钟)

-学生活动:

-学生根据教师提供的任务,独立或分组编写程序,实现特定功能。

-学生展示自己的程序,其他同学提出改进意见。

-教师指导:

-教师巡视课堂,观察学生编程过程,及时发现并解决学生在编程过程中遇到的问题。

-教师对学生的程序进行点评,强调编程规范和代码可读性。

4.课堂小结(约5分钟)

-教师总结本节课的学习内容,强调“如果”结构和“广播”命令的重要性。

-回顾学生课堂表现,肯定优秀案例,提出改进建议。

5.作业布置(约2分钟)

-布置课后练习,要求学生独立完成一个包含“如果”条件和“广播”命令的程序设计。

-提醒学生注意程序的可读性和逻辑性,鼓励创新思维。

6.教学反思(课后)

-教师对本次课程进行反思,总结教学过程中的成功经验和不足之处。

-根据学生的反馈和课堂表现,调整教学方法,提高教学效果。知识点梳理1.程序设计基础概念

-程序:计算机执行的一系列指令,用于完成特定任务。

-指令:程序中的基本操作单元,用于指导计算机执行具体动作。

-变量:用于存储数据的命名空间,可以保存数值、文本等。

2.条件语句

-“如果”结构:根据条件判断结果,执行不同的代码块。

-语法规则:条件判断语句通常包含条件、判断结果和对应操作。

-应用场景:适用于需要根据不同条件执行不同操作的程序。

3.“广播”命令

-功能:将信息发送给所有或部分接收者。

-语法规则:使用特定的指令或函数,实现信息的广播。

-应用场景:适用于多人协作或需要实时通信的程序。

4.程序编写步骤

-分析问题:明确程序需要解决的问题和目标。

-设计算法:根据问题分析,设计解决问题的步骤和方法。

-编写代码:将设计好的算法转化为可执行的程序代码。

-调试程序:检查程序运行过程中的错误,并进行修改。

5.错误处理与调试

-错误类型:逻辑错误、语法错误、运行时错误等。

-调试方法:通过打印输出、添加调试语句、逐步执行等方式查找和修复错误。

6.编程规范与代码可读性

-命名规范:合理命名变量、函数和类,提高代码可读性。

-格式规范:使用一致的缩进、空格和注释,使代码整齐有序。

-注释:对代码进行必要的解释,方便他人阅读和理解。

7.程序设计思维方式

-抽象思维:将实际问题抽象为程序设计问题。

-逻辑思维:根据条件判断和执行顺序,设计合理的程序流程。

-算法思维:将实际问题转化为算法,实现高效解决问题的方法。

8.团队合作与沟通

-分工合作:明确团队成员的职责,提高工作效率。

-沟通交流:及时沟通项目进展和遇到的问题,确保项目顺利进行。

9.信息技术与社会责任

-合理使用信息技术:提高信息素养,正确使用网络资源。

-遵守网络安全规则:保护个人隐私,维护网络安全。

-培养创新意识:勇于尝试新技术,推动信息技术发展。板书设计1.程序设计基础

①程序定义

②指令概念

③变量作用

2.条件语句

①“如果”结构

②条件判断语法

③条件分支应用

3.“广播”命令

①广播功能

②广播命令语法

③广播命令应用场景

4.程序编写步骤

①分析问题

②设计算法

③编写代码

④调试程序

5.错误处理与调试

①错误类型

②调试方法

③调试技巧

6.编程规范与代码可读性

①命名规范

②格式规范

③注释使用

7.程序设计思维方式

①抽象思维

②逻辑思维

③算法思维

8.团队合作与沟通

①分工合作

②沟通交流

③团队协作

9.信息技术与社会责任

①合理使用信息技术

②遵守网络安全规则

③培养创新意识教学评价与反馈1.课堂表现:

-观察学生在课堂上的参与度,包括提问、回答问题、参与讨论等。

-评价学生的专注力,如是否认真听讲,是否能够跟随教学进度。

-评估学生的积极性,如是否主动参与实验操作,是否对编程有浓厚的兴趣。

2.小组讨论成果展示:

-评价小组合作的效果,包括成员间的沟通、分工、协作情况。

-分析小组讨论的深度和广度,如是否能够提出有见地的问题和解决方案。

-评估小组展示的清晰度和逻辑性,如是否能够有效地传达小组的成果。

3.随堂测试:

-通过随堂测试评估学生对“如果”结构和“广播”命令的理解程度。

-评价学生在测试中的准确性和速度,以了解他们对知识的掌握情况。

-分析测试中常见的错误类型,以帮助教师调整教学策略。

4.课后作业反馈:

-评估学生课后作业的质量,包括程序的正确性、代码的整洁性和功能的完整性。

-通过作业反馈了解学生对知识的实际应用能力。

-针对作业中的问题,提供个别指导,帮助学生克服学习

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论